Vincent DeMasi
A full-time musician and guitar teacher since 1995, Vincent specializes in
rock, blues, and jazz and is especially patient with adult beginners! He
holds a BS in Jazz and Commercial music from Hofstra and a BA in Musicology
from L.I.U. Vincent has published hundreds of six-string-related articles
and is a regular monthly contributor of how-to lessons and transcriptions to
"Guitar Player" and "Frets" magazines--including penning the July 2007 cover
story/lesson feature. Five of Vincent's lesson columns were chosen for
inclusion in Hal Leonard's 2008 publication "The Guitar Player Book." When
not teaching, Vincent can be found on-stage rocking a crowded dance floor
with his party-rock band the Mulligans, playing solo acoustic gigs to
support his 2007 solo instrumental CD "Sketches for Sofia," or replicating
the mesmerizing guitar tones of The Edge with leading tri-state area U2
tribute band U2 Nation. He has also appeared on Broadway as an understudy
lead guitarist in the Billy Joel/Twyla Tharp collaborative "Moving Out" and
performed with Herb Reed's Platters, Steam, Marilyn Michaels, and many
others. At NYC Guitar School, Vincent is the designer and teacher of the
Classic Rock, U2, Heavy Metal, Red Hot Chili Peppers, and
intermediate/advanced Guns and Roses classes and also offers his guidance to
Adult Rock Band courses. Vincent lives in "wine country" Long Island with
his wife Priscilla and daughter Sofia Rose and wakes up every morning
totally psyched to be able to play and teach guitar for a living.
